(Springfield, IL) -- Governor J.B. Pritzker is signing legislation authorizing a new state-based marketplace for Illinois.

Illinois residents currently access the Affordable Care Act Marketplace through the federal platform.

The full state-based marketplace is expected to go live in 2026.

The governor also signed rate review legislation designed to protect health insurance consumers from unfair rate hikes.

Insurance companies must provide specific details about how they set their rates and the Illinois Department of Insurance has the authority to approve, modify, or disapprove health premium rates that it determines to be unreasonable or insufficient.
